How much does it cost to rent a home in Somerville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Somerville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,881 | $2,000 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,765 | $420 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,596 | $3,000 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,551 | $3,900 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,660 | $5,000 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,975 | $7,975 | $7,975 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Somerville
What type of rentals are currently available in Somerville?
There are currently 12112 Apartments for Rent in Somerville, MA with pricing that ranges from $725 to $21,000. There are also 6238 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Somerville ranging from $420 to $22,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Somerville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Somerville ranges from $420 to $22,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,264.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Somerville?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Somerville range from $925 to $21,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$420 to $22,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,000 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$825.
